Why Your Humanities Degree is a Secret Weapon in Analytics
The humanities provide a competitive advantage in analytics by teaching students how to ask the right questions, identify bias in information, and communicate complex findings to diverse audiences. While technical experts can run models, humanities-trained professionals can explain what those models mean for human behavior and business strategy.
In my work as a strategist, I often see “pure” technical analysts struggle to explain their work to executives. They can show you a spreadsheet, but they can’t tell you the story. This is where you come in. As a humanities major, you have spent years looking for “the why” behind a text. In analytics, “the why” is what earns you a seat at the leadership table.
Consider the following table which compares the standard academic skill to its direct application in the data world:
| Humanities Skill | Analytics Application | Business Value |
|---|---|---|
| Textual Analysis | Sentiment Analysis / NLP | Understanding customer feedback |
| Historical Context | Trend Analysis | Predicting future market shifts |
| Argument Construction | Data Storytelling | Persuading stakeholders to take action |
| Research Methodology | Data Cleaning & Ethics | Ensuring data integrity and privacy |

Mapping the Technical Skills Gap
The technical skills gap refers to the difference between the qualitative skills gained in a humanities program and the quantitative tools required by the modern labor market. Bridging this gap involves learning specific software and programming languages that allow you to manipulate and visualize data effectively.
You do not need a second degree to bridge this gap. You need a targeted selection of tools. In my experience mentoring recent graduates, those who focus on three core areas see the highest return on investment (ROI).
- Spreadsheet Mastery (Excel): This is the “lingua franca” of business. If you can master VLOOKUPs, Pivot Tables, and basic macros, you are already ahead of 50% of the workforce.
- Database Querying (SQL): SQL is how you talk to databases. It is a logical language that feels very similar to learning the grammar of a foreign language.
- Data Visualization (Tableau or Power BI): These tools allow you to turn numbers into charts. This is where your storytelling skills will shine.

Career Transitions with a Degree: The Upskilling Phase
Upskilling is the process of learning new skills to stay relevant in the workforce or to move into a different career path. For humanities professionals, this phase is about adding quantitative “layers” to their existing qualitative foundation without needing to start their education over from scratch.
A realistic timeline for this transition is 6 to 12 months. During this time, you should aim to build a portfolio. A portfolio is a collection of projects that prove you can do the work. If you are an English major, don’t just say you are “analytical.” Show a project where you took a public dataset (like Census data or Twitter feeds) and used Excel or SQL to find a trend.
- Month 1-3: Take a foundational course in Data Analytics (Google Data Analytics Certificate or similar).
- Month 4-6: Complete three “capstone” projects. Use real-world data to solve a problem.
- Month 7-12: Update your LinkedIn and resume to highlight your “Hybrid” status. Use phrases like “Data-driven storyteller” or “Quantitative Researcher.”
The conversion rate from internship to full-time job is currently around 57%. If you are a student, getting an internship in an analytical department—even if it’s just as a generalist—is the fastest way to secure a post-grad role.

Actionable Strategies for Your Transition
To maximize your employability, you must treat your job search like a research project. Use tools like O*NET to see which skills are trending in your target roles. Use LinkedIn Career Explorer to see where people with your degree ended up five years after graduation.
- Informational Interviews: Reach out to three people on LinkedIn who have “Data Analyst” titles but “History” or “Philosophy” degrees. Ask them how they made the jump.
- The “Skills-Based” Resume: Move your “Education” section to the bottom. Put a “Technical Skills” and “Projects” section at the top. Recruiters spend 6 seconds on a resume; show them the tools first.
- Networking over Applications: 70% of jobs are never published. Use your alumni network. People love helping others who share their “unconventional” background.
Common Obstacles and How to Overcome Them
The biggest obstacle is the “imposter syndrome” that comes from being the only person in the room without a Computer Science degree. You might feel like you are behind, but your ability to read a room, write a clear email, and think critically is something many technical professionals spend years trying to learn.
Another common mistake is trying to learn everything at once. You do not need to be a master of Python, R, Java, and C++ to get an entry-level analytics job. Start with Excel and SQL. These two tools alone power the vast majority of business decisions made today.
Finally, avoid the “certificate trap.” Getting ten certificates without a single project to show for it is a waste of time. Employers want to see what you built, not what you watched on a video.
Frequently Asked Questions (FAQ)
What can I do with this degree if I graduated in English or History? You can pursue roles in market research, business intelligence, UX research, or data journalism. Your degree has trained you to synthesize large amounts of information and communicate findings. By adding basic data skills like Excel or SQL, you become a “data storyteller,” a role that bridges the gap between technical data and business strategy.
Is it too late to transition to analytics if I am mid-career? Absolutely not. Mid-career professionals often have the “domain expertise” that young graduates lack. If you have worked in retail for ten years and then learn analytics, you aren’t just a “junior analyst.” You are an “Analytics Consultant with a decade of retail expertise.” This makes you much more valuable to a retail company than someone who only knows the math.
Do I need to go back to school for a Master’s degree? In most cases, no. While a Master’s in Data Science can be helpful, it is expensive and time-consuming. Most entry-level and mid-level roles prioritize skills and experience over a specific degree. A portfolio of real-world projects and a few industry-recognized certifications (like the Tableau Desktop Specialist or Google Data Analytics) are often enough to get your foot in the door.
How long does a career roadmap after a bachelor’s usually take to show results? If you are actively upskilling, you can see significant results in 6 to 12 months. This includes the time to learn the tools, build a portfolio, and navigate the interview process. Most career switchers find their first “bridge” role within a year of starting their technical training.
What are the best majors for the job market if I want to work in tech? While CS is the obvious choice, “Philosophy” and “Linguistics” are surprisingly highly regarded in AI and Natural Language Processing (NLP). The best major is one you are passionate about, provided you are willing to layer on technical skills. The market is moving toward “skills-based hiring,” meaning your ability to perform tasks matters more than the name on your diploma.
How do I explain my humanities degree to a technical hiring manager? Frame it as a strength. Say, “My background in history taught me how to analyze complex systems and identify long-term trends. I’ve combined that analytical foundation with SQL and Tableau to help businesses turn raw data into actionable stories.” This shows you value your education and understand its practical application.
What is the average salary growth for this career transition? Most professionals see a 20-30% salary increase when moving from a general administrative or humanities role into an analytical one. Within five years, as you move from “Junior Analyst” to “Senior Analyst” or “Manager,” salaries typically cross the six-figure mark, depending on the industry and location.
What tools should I learn first for a degree to career pathway in analytics? Start with Excel (Advanced level). Then move to SQL for database management. Finally, learn a visualization tool like Tableau or Power BI. If you want to go deeper into data science later, you can add Python or R, but these are not usually required for your first role in business or marketing analytics.
What is the internship-to-job conversion rate for these roles? The conversion rate is approximately 57-60%. Internships are the most effective way to “prove” your analytical capabilities to an employer who might be skeptical of your humanities background. Even a “Data Intern” role at a non-profit can serve as a powerful launchpad for a corporate career.
How do I handle the “years of experience” requirement in job postings? Many “entry-level” jobs ask for 2-3 years of experience. You can meet this requirement by counting your university research projects, internships, and the independent projects in your portfolio. If you can show a hiring manager a dashboard you built that solves a real problem, they are often willing to overlook a lack of formal “years” in the field.
